Responsibility
- Provide timely and effective technical support to end-users, resolving hardware, software, and network issues.
- Install, configure, and maintain workstations, servers, and peripheral devices.
- Monitor system performance and implement proactive measures to prevent downtime.
- Troubleshoot and resolve network connectivity and security-related issues.
- Assist in the deployment and management of cloud-based services and applications.
- Document technical issues, solutions, and procedures for future reference.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ure IT infrastructure aligns with business needs.
- Conduct regular system backups and disaster recovery procedures.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in IT support, system administration, or a similar role.
- Strong knowledge of Windows/Linux operating systems, networking protocols, and troubleshooting tools.
- Experience with helpdesk software, remote support tools, and ticketing systems.
- Familiarity with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ud) is a plus.
-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to work under pressure.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ills to interact with non-technical users.
- Certifications such as CompTIA A+, Network+, or Microsoft Certified IT Professional (MCITP) are advantageous.
